Invoicing in Euros

The package looks good but does it have any way of invoicing in Euros?

You can change the currency by clicking menu Setup > Currency Symbol >
Euro. However this will change the currency for all amounts.

You may find it easier to create two data files - one containing Euro
invoices and another with the equivalent invoice in Pounds.

Sorry no, I mean your main data file would be in pounds. This would record ALL your transactions, including Euro invoices and Euro expenses converted using the appropriate exchange rate. You would only need to add an invoice to the 'Euro' data file when you need to send a Euro invoice to customer.

To be honest this approach is really only designed for the occasional foreign-currency transaction. If you have many Euro transactions or a Euro bank account you may prefer other software packages such as Quickbooks Pro or Kashflow.
